Street Scene, 1h20
Directed by King Vidor, H. Bruce Humberstone
Origin USA
Genres Drama, Romance
Themes Films about sexuality, Théâtre, Films based on plays
Actors Estelle Taylor, Walter Miller, Sylvia Sidney, William Collier Jr., Beulah Bondi, David Landau

On a hot summer afternoon in New York, Emma Jones gossips with other neighbors in her residential building about the affair that Mrs. Anna Maurrant and the milkman Steve Sankey are having. When the rude and unfriendly Mr. Frank Maurrant arrives, they change the subject. Meanwhile, their teenage daughter Rose Maurrant is being sexually pressured by her married boss Mr. Bert Easter. She does however very much like her kind young Jewish neighbor Sam, who has a serious crush on her.

Hunting Scenes from Bavaria, 1h20
Directed by Peter Fleischmann
Origin German
Genres Drama, Horror
Themes Films about sexuality, LGBT-related films, Films based on plays, LGBT-related films, LGBT-related film
Actors Hanna Schygulla, Angela Winkler

In a small village in Lower Bavaria, twenty-year-old mechanic Abram (Martin Sperr) is suspected of being homosexual. He is not the only outsider, as also present are a foreign guest worker and the maidservant Hannelore (Angela Winkler), who is defamed as a whore by the villagers. When Abram knifes Hannelore the situation escalates and the hysterical villagers try to hunt Abram down.

Shadow Over The Islands, 1h38
Genres Drama
Themes Seafaring films, Transport films
Actors Erwin Geschonneck, Fritz Diez, Rudolf Wessely, Friedrich Gnaß

In a small village on the Faroe Islands, the people's only source of income is trapping a local breed of wild birds. The corrupt capitalist Mr. Brause exploits the locals, forcing them to work for a low wage while selling the birds with a high profit. A disease strikes the village, and many inhabitants become ill. A local physician, Dr. Stefan Horn, discovers that the source of the sickness is the birds. He sends a telegram to a medical research institute in Copenhagen. The scientists in the capital corroborate his suspicions. Brause destroys their letter and tells the villagers that they can continue with their trade. Eventually, Stefan and his cousin, Arne, manage to expose the truth before the people. Brause flees the islands.
